Description
In medieval China, master artisans compete to become the Grand Master craftsman, known as Zong Shi. You're one of these skilled artisans, aiming to impress the townspeople with your expertise. To succeed, you'll need to strategically manage your resources and projects, deciding whether to specialize in certain materials or expand your workshop. With the help of your apprentice, you'll take on various projects, from smaller tasks to grand masterworks. As you play, you'll blend worker placement, resource management, and special actions to outdo your opponents. With a playtime of 60 to 90 minutes, Zong Shi offers a engaging experience for 3 to 5 players. Designed by Kevin G. Nunn, this 2012 game provides a fun and challenging experience, with opportunities to visit townspersons, acquire new materials, and complete projects to earn points. The game's normal complexity makes it accessible to fans of board games, and its medieval setting adds a unique twist to the gameplay.
